> Anyone ever seen nil passed to isEqual:?  Is the SDK declaration maybe wrong?

Check the class documentation, not just the header. The parameter is declared 
as:
        anObject        The object to be compared to the receiver. May be nil, 
in which case this method returns NO.

So yes, the parameter should be declared as `nullable`.
